About Madison Square Garden Entertain

About Madison Square Garden Entertain

Madison Square Garden Entertainment Corp. operates five venues across New York City and Chicago — Madison Square Garden (seating approximately 21,000), The Theater at Madison Square Garden, Radio City Music Hall, Beacon Theatre, and The Chicago Theatre — hosting nearly 6 million guests at more than 975 events in Fiscal Year 2025. The Christmas Spectacular sold approximately 1.1 million tickets across 200 performances that fiscal year, representing 18% of company revenues.

MSGE earns revenue through multiple streams: event ticketing for concerts, sporting events, family shows, and special events at its five venues; arena license fees from MSG Sports under 35-year Arena License Agreements requiring the NBA's Knicks and NHL's Rangers to play home games at The Garden through 2055; premium suite licenses at The Garden (23 event-level spaces, 58 Lexus Level suites, and 18 Infosys Level suites, primarily structured as multi-year corporate agreements with annual escalators); sponsorship and signage sold jointly with MSG Sports under a sales representation agreement; and food, beverage, and merchandise sales. The company primarily licenses its venues to third-party promoters for a fee rather than promoting directly — limiting direct revenue risk on individual events — though co-promotion positions do expose the company to event-level economic risk. The Christmas Spectacular, for which the company has held rights since 1997, runs exclusively at Radio City Music Hall and contributes 18% of revenues from roughly 200 annual performances.

MSGE's revenues are highly sensitive to consumer and corporate discretionary spending and to local economic conditions in New York City, where four of its five venues operate. Following the 2008 financial crisis, the company experienced lower event bookings and reduced suite license renewals. Government-mandated capacity restrictions during COVID-19 forced venues to close for 'the substantial majority of Fiscal Year 2021.' A separate regulatory risk stems from the Madison Square Garden Complex's zoning special permit, renewed for only five years in September 2023, with Amtrak, the MTA, and NJ Transit asserting in a June 2023 compatibility report that The Garden 'imposes severe constraints on Penn Station' and calling for significant cash contributions and property transfers as conditions of future permit renewal.
